1. A method of a flight management system (FMS) for dynamically computing an equi-distance point (EDP) for an aircraft, comprising:

  • receiving, by a processor, at least two reference points for landing the aircraft upon an occurrence of an emergency;

    determining, by the processor, a remaining flight path for the aircraft based on a current location of the aircraft and a flight plan serviced by the flight management system (FMS) of the aircraft; and

    generating, by the processor, the EDP for the aircraft by locating a point on the remaining flight path which is equidistant from the at least two reference points.
